Korean Marinated Boiled Eggs

 

Been craving boiled eggs with a savory, spicy flavor.  I like the simplicity of ingredients that is easy to snack on or pop into a bowl of noodles drizzled with extra marinade from the eggs. The garlic, sesame oil and chili pepper flakes are a tasty combination.

Ingredients

  • 9 eggs
  • 1 head of garlic, minced
  • 1 bunch of green onions, chopped 
  • 1 T sesame seeds
  • 1 T Korean chili pepper flakes
  • 1 C shoyu
  • ½ C honey
  • 1 T sesame oil
  • ½ C water 

 

Directions

  1. Bring pot of water to a boil and add eggs for 6 minutes.
  2. Immediately remove eggs and let it rest in a bowl of ice water for at least 10 minutes. Peel carefully and set them aside. 
  3. In a shallow glass container, add garlic, chopped green onion, shoyu, chili pepper flakes, honey, sesame oil, and water. Mix till everything is combined. Add in the peel eggs and making sure the eggs are covered in the marinade. Let the eggs rest in the fridge for a few hours.
  4. Serve with a bowl of hot rice, noodles or a snack.
